November 16, 2008
Chris Johnson was held in check for the second straight week, as he managed just 64 yards on 17 carries (3.8 YPC) in the win over Jacksonville Sunday. He added four catches for 24 yards.

Our View:Opposing teams are beginning to stack the box in an effort to stop the Titans' running game. It has worked, but Kerry Collins is proving to be a capable passer. Even with Collins playing well, we wouldn't be surprised if Tennessee's opponents continue to make him beat them, meaning Johnson and LenDale White could have trouble producing for fantasy owners like they have been.
November 7, 2008
Chris Johnson could get more touches with the Titans, according to the Nashville City Paper. Coach Jeff Fisher said, "We’re trying to do a little bit more with him each week, and keep in mind, he gets a lot of practice reps and experience on the practice field, and it’s carried over into games. He’s making the different catches, the different runs and different cuts. He’s a complete back. He can catch it, accelerate and go."

Our View:The rookie has exceeded expectations so far, but offensive coordinator Mike Heimerdinger does not want to overwork him, potentially tiring him out when they need him the most for their playoff run. He should remain active in fantasy lineups, even with a tough match-up against Chicago.
November 2, 2008
Running back Chris Johnson lugged the rock 24 times for 89 yards and one touchdown in the Week 9 victory over Green Bay.

Our View:Johnson, who also chipped in six receptions for 72 yards, has scored a touchdown in three straight weeks.
October 27, 2008
Chris Johnson led the Titans with 19 carries for 77 yards on Monday night as he also found his way into the end zone on a late 16-yard score.

Our View:Until that run with under four minutes left this was shaping up to be a poor night for Johnson. Still, the kid ended up producing another solid effort as he seemingly always finds a way to get it done.
October 25, 2008
Colts' coach Tony Dungy praised Titans' rookie running back Chris Johnson, according to the Tennessean. Dungy said, "He's been exceptional. In Mike Heimerdinger's offense, I think he has a chance to be like Terrell Davis and have that super year and really catapult them into the upper echelon."

Our View:Dungy and the Colts will attempt to slow down Johnson in Monday's AFC South showdown with the Titans. Johnson currently leads the AFC with 549 rushing yards, and the Colts field the 28th ranked run defense, making him a solid start in fantasy leagues.
